Bonnie Orr Biography
Courtesy: Marist Athletics
Release: 06/01/2011

2011-12: MAAC All-Academic Team ... ECAC Champion: 800-Yard Freestyle Relay ... Swam in all three distance freestyle Championship Finals at the 2012 MAAC Championships ... Her third place finish in the 1000-yd freestyle highlighted her performance as she finished int 10:19.03 ... Took fourth in the 1650- at 17:26.65 and fifth in the 500-yd freestyle at 5:02.82 ... Was part of the title-winning 800-yd freestyle relay team, who clocked in at 7:33.34.

At the ECAC Championships, she secured a 13th place finish in the 1650-yd freestyle with a time of 17:27.11 ... Finished 18th in the both the 500-yd freestyle (5:08.11) and the 100-yd butterfly (58.50) ... Helped Marist earn its first ECAC relay title since 2007 in the 800-yd freestyle event with a time of 7:31.51.

2010-11: MAAC Record-Holder and Champion: 800-yd. Freestyle Relay ... In first ever MAAC Championship event, finished the 500-yd freestyle in fourth place with a time of 5:02.05 ... Swam to a third place finish in the 1000-yd freestyle with a time of 10:26.19 (fourth- best in Marist history) ... Finished in third place in her final individual distance event for the Red Foxes, the 1650-yd freestyle with a time of 17:27.31 (fourth-best in Marist history) ... Member of the first place and MAAC and Marist record-holding 800-yd freestyle relay team, who finished with a time of 7:31.19.

At the ECAC Championships, took 13th place in the 1650-yd freestyle event with a time of 17:43.85 ... Participated in the 500-yd freestyle race and finished with a time of 5:11.16 ... Swam the 100-yd butterfly in a time of 59.30, a mark that left her just 0.29 seconds shy of qualifying for the B-Final ... Member of the second place finishing 800-yd freestyle relay team

Prior to Marist: Before joining the Red Foxes, Orr served as team captain during her senior year and set league records in the 200-yd. individual medley and the 100-yd. butterfly in three straight seasons. She did not lose a scholastic meet since her sophomore year in high school, when she was named the team MVP. She won the high school championship in the 200-yd. IM with a time of 2:10.68. During her junior and senior seasons, Orr swam in the California/Nevada sectionals while being named Second Team All-Valley California Interscholastic Federation (CIF) after her sophomore and junior seasons. In addition to her swimming accomplishments, Orr also lettered in water polo where she was named First Team All-League and Second Team All-Valley.
